In present scenario Network Management System of Next Generation SDH is not performing Offline reporting, offline analysis of alarms, offline performance management and Configurations of network like real time. Any offline configuration of a network when implemented on a real time environment leaves some shortcomings and wrong configuration attributes due to non-availability of Alarms and Performance Management in the presently available offline utility. A simulated platform is developed for implementation of a traffic matrix in an offline environment before implementing over a real time NG SDH Transmission network to reduce the chance of faults or any network disaster.

The current data collection of a network device in the network management system exists low real-time and long polling cycle, this paper proposes a subnet broadcast algorithm based on SNMP. The algorithm introduces the idea of Subnet division and broadcasting, when polling, the algorithm polled network devices by sending a SNMP data broadcast packet to each subnet, which reduced the polling packets, shortened the polling cycle and lightened the burden of management station, thus the proposed algorithm improves real-time and work efficiency for the large-scale network management system.

Based on analyzing EPON Network architectures and EPON Network Management functional requirements, this paper designed an EPON Network management System according to configuration management, performance management, fault management, topology management, security management and log management, and achieved a system based on RIA technology and B/S mode. The client was written based on Flex framework and the server was written by JAVA. A middleware technology was used between client and server for communicating. Through the B/S mode and SNMP, the system has achieved a series of management functions of EPON network.

As the work for managing a whole LAN effectively withoutlimited purposes, there are works of Policy-based networkmanagement (PBNM). The existing PBNM is defined in someorganizations including the Internet Engineering Task Force(IETF). However, it has structural problems. For example,communications sent from many clients concentrate on acommunication control mechanism called PEP (PolicyEnforcement Point). To improve the problems, we have beenstudying next generation PBNM called Destination AddressingControl System (DACS) Scheme. The DACS Scheme controlsthe whole LAN through communication control by the clientsoftware as PEP which locates on a client computer. We havebeen studied on the aspect of principle until now. In thisresearch, we implement a DACS system to realize a concept ofthe DACS Scheme, and show implement method and results offunctional experiments.

Web-based network management revolving about database puts forward a feasible mode for network information processing and has the characteristics of wide distribution, full interactivity, real-time dynamic and so on in the application; and is beneficial to timely adjustment for network performance and rapid recovery for fault. Combining the technologies of JSP, JavaBean, JDBC, Socket, JavaApplet, Ajax, JavaScript and so on, database-centric network management mode ensures the reliable, efficient and stable operation of configuration, performance, fault, security and accounting management in the development of business network management system, such as TD-SCDMA network, PON network, TMPLS network, IPTV network, power network and so on. In practice, it is worth mentioning that it improves the dynamical and real-time release performance of accounting management, realizes web-based management for rate and bill. Customers could receive bills real-timely in internet and deals with them conveniently. This is propitious to the management of network vendors as well.
